UV Xenon Medium Pressure Lamps
UV Xenon Medium Pressure Lamps provide a broad and continuous emission spectrum across UV and visible light, making them highly versatile light sources for industrial and scientific applications. Their strong UV output enables efficient processes such as disinfection, photochemistry, aging simulation, and curing. In addition, the high power density of xenon lamps supports compact system designs and fast treatment speeds, improving productivity and throughput.
With mercury-free lamp options available, particularly in pulsed systems, they offer a more environmentally friendly alternative to conventional UV lamp technologies.

Typical Applications of UV Xenon Medium Pressure Lamps:
Weathering
Xenon lamps are frequently used in sun simulation applications. Thanks to their nearly continuous spectrum from UV to IR, they are an ideal light source for simulating the effects of sunlight exposure on adhesives, coatings, colors (fading), and materials such as plastics that may fade, become brittle, or porous over time.
They are considered one of the most reliable sources for testing the degradation of products exposed to sunlight, as they reproduce the daylight spectrum very accurately.Copyboard Lighting
Xenon lamps are commonly used to illuminate small horizontal copyboards as well as large vertical ones.
Due to their spectral power distribution, XOP lamps are particularly suitable for high-quality color reproduction. For black-and-white reproduction, they often outperform other light sources in terms of clarity and contrast.Stop-and-Repeat Copying Machines
XOP lamps are extremely useful in stop-and-repeat copying systems because they do not require any run-up time and provide full light output instantly.Strobe Lighting
Xenon lamps are widely used for stroboscopic lighting applications where short, intense light flashes are required. Typical applications include:
• Dance and night clubs – creating slow-motion visual effects
• Emergency vehicles and warning situations
• Alarm systems
• Theatre lighting
• Running lights
• Special effects such as haunted houses or outdoor Halloween displays
